Transaction 3964f62536f56d9da32afb0ceeb772a4823e4624ca02fa427c1d527615fdab0e

1 Input
2 Outputs
  • 3964f62536f56d9da32afb0ceeb772a4823e4624ca02fa427c1d527615fdab0e:0
  • value  515005
    address  17XNAekobVDFbn45NY3wK4gjapERp8nfmA
  • 3964f62536f56d9da32afb0ceeb772a4823e4624ca02fa427c1d527615fdab0e:1
  • value  7039872
    address  12dcfKoPVzHNb4xiftTYSD9hKHQ8NKFmmA